  3. Unfortunately, placing a cartridge backwards into a magazine does nothing at all. The firing pin would strike the bullet itself, and wouldn't ignite the primer on the back of the round. But, most automatic rifles and really anything that takes a magazine would foul, as the bullet would not be able to fit into the breach like that. It would likely require a couple seconds for the player to figure that out and then drop the mag out, thus requiring them a few seconds of time to unjam the gun.     I beg to differ on .22 ammunition. There are multiple stories where the rounds are able to penetrate the head, either from the eye or through the skull itself, but do not have the velocity or force necessary to exit, and instead pinball around the inside of the cranium for several bounces. You can imagine how very dead a person would be if this happened. There are versions of the .22 that can achieve nearly four thousand fps muzzle velocities, as well.
